Step 3

design by Erikia Ghumm

3. Decide on the placement of the rulers and frames. Measure and mark the position of the holes on the frames 1/2" from the sides and 1/8" from the tops and bottoms. Then drill or punch the following holes: in the first and second frames, punch two holes in the top and two in the bottom; in the third frame, punch two holes in the top and one hole in the center bottom.
